Sourcing guidance for E Moto Bike

What are the key technical specifications to evaluate when sourcing E Moto Bikes?

When selecting an E Moto Bike, the battery system is the most critical component; prioritize L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4) or Ternary Lithium batteries for high energy density and safety. Ensure the motor power (typically ranging from 3kW to 10kW for mid-range models) matches your target market's speed requirements. Additionally, verify the Controller's IP rating (IP67 recommended) to ensure water resistance and the BMS (Battery Management System) capabilities for overcharge and thermal protection.

Which international compliance standards are mandatory for E Moto Bikes?

Compliance varies by destination: for the European market, products must have CE certification and e-Mark (EEC/COC) for road legality. For the US market, adherence to DOT (Department of Transportation) and EPA standards is required, along with UL 2272 for battery safety. Always request UN38.3 test reports for battery transport safety to avoid customs seizures.

How can I assess the structural durability and safety of an electric motorcycle?

Request documentation on frame stress testing and ensure the use of high-tensile steel or aluminum alloy. The braking system should ideally feature CBS (Combined Braking System) or 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) for rider safety. For high-speed models, verify that the tires are E4 or DOT certified and that the suspension system is adjustable to handle different terrains.

What customization (OEM/ODM) options should I discuss with suppliers?

Professional suppliers on Made-in-China.com usually offer branding (logo placement), color scheme customization, and battery capacity upgrades. You should also inquire about firmware customization for the digital display (LCD/TFT) to support local languages and metric/imperial unit switching.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for E Moto Bikes

What are the primary risks in cross-border E Moto Bike purchasing?

The biggest risk is battery degradation or safety issues during long-term transit. Ensure the supplier uses specialized UN-rated dangerous goods packaging. Another risk is regulatory non-compliance; if the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) or COC (Certificate of Conformity) is incorrect, the vehicle cannot be registered for road use.

How should I negotiate shipping and logistics for electric vehicles?

E Moto Bikes are classified as Class 9 Dangerous Goods due to the batteries. Negotiate for FOB (Free On Board) terms if you have a specialized forwarder, or C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) if the supplier has expertise in DG (Dangerous Goods) shipping. Always include shipping insurance that covers 'hidden damage' to the electrical systems.

What strategies ensure transaction security when dealing with new suppliers?

Utilize Secured Trading Services provided by Made-in-China.com to protect your payments. Never pay the full amount upfront; a standard 30% deposit and 70% balance after third-party inspection (like SGS or TUV) is the industry benchmark. Conduct a Video Factory Audit to verify the supplier's assembly line and testing equipment.

How do I handle after-sales support for technical components?

Negotiate a 1-2% spare parts kit (controllers, throttles, lights) to be included in the container. Ensure the supplier provides English-language service manuals and video tutorials for troubleshooting. Confirm the warranty period for the battery and motor, which should ideally be at least 12 to 24 months.
